在许多场景下,你可能需要从外部网络访问位于内部网络中的服务。例如,远程桌面连接到家里的电脑、通过公网访问实验室的私有服务器等。本文将指导你如何使用阿里云服务器来搭建一个简单的内网穿透解决方案。
什么是内网穿透?
内网穿透是一种技术手段,它允许用户通过互联网安全地访问局域网内的资源或服务。这种访问方式对于那些没有公网IP地址或者防火墙限制了直接入站连接的情况尤其有用。
准备工具与环境
为了实现内网穿透,你需要以下几项:
- 一台运行Linux系统的阿里云ECS实例(作为frp服务器)。
- 至少一台Windows系统电脑(作为frp客户端),这台电脑上开启了RDP服务或其他需要被外网访问的服务。
- 下载并安装frp软件包,该软件分为两部分:frps(服务端)和frpc(客户端)。
配置步骤
服务端配置 (frps)
- 登录至你的阿里云ECS实例。
- 下载最新版本的frp,并解压。
- 编辑frps.ini文件,设置监听端口和其他参数。
- 启动frps服务。
客户端配置 (frpc)
- 在你的Windows机器上下载对应的frp客户端。
- 创建并编辑frpc.ini文件,配置本地服务信息以及指向阿里云ECS实例的信息。
- 运行frpc客户端程序。
测试连接
完成上述配置后,你可以尝试从外部网络连接到Windows机器上的服务。如果一切配置无误,你应该能够成功建立连接。
安全注意事项
虽然frp提供了一种方便的方式来进行内网穿透,但请务必注意安全问题。确保使用强密码保护所有服务,并定期更新frp软件以防止潜在的安全漏洞。仅暴露必要的服务给外部网络,尽量减少攻击面。
借助阿里云强大的基础设施,您可以轻松部署高效的内网穿透方案。如果您正计划实施这样的解决方案,请记得先领取『阿里云优惠券』,再购买阿里云产品,这样可以节省成本,获得更佳体验。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/373761.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。